NEW BRIGHTON, Minn. (AP) — A man died after state troopers stunned him with a Taser when they said he became "uncooperative" after being involved in a wreck.

The State Patrol said five troopers were placed on standard, administrative leave after the man's death Tuesday. A patrol spokesman would not describe what kind of "uncooperative" behavior was involved.
